League 2 Champions and Runners-Up decided

By Phil Woosnam

Knighton and Hay St Mary's promoted subject to criteria

Knighton deservedly won the Division 2 league after a comprehensive 6-0 victory over Dyffryn Banw at Bryn-y-Castell this afternoon.
Connor Bird was the hero with a five goal haul which settled the Division 2 championship.
As Secretary Phil Woosnam said after the match, they only lost once all season at Bont by 6-0 so won the trophy on merit.
A large crowd was in attendance and they now rightfully regain their spot in Spar 1 after a number of years away.
Also, going up, subject to a criteria inspection will be Hay St Mary's who, although not playing today, get promoted due to Kerry'sbdefeat at Churchstoke.
Hay have only lost three times this season and also deserve their place back in the top flight.
